Practical tips for your first visit to Smilehealth in Cuenca
- Bring personal ID (passport if you’re a visitor) and any previous dental records or X-rays.
- Prepare a list of medications and medical conditions — this is critical for safe sedation or surgical care.
- Ask for a written treatment plan with step-by-step timelines and itemized costs.
- If you plan on implants, inquire about CBCT scanning and surgical guides — these improve placement accuracy.
- Schedule follow-up appointments in advance, especially if you’re traveling from abroad.
- If sedation is needed, arrange for a companion or transportation after the appointment.
